SoundCloud is looking to enhance its iOS Artist experience to connect millions of users with music and artists they love, by delivering seamless, high-quality experiences for Artists on iOS.
Requirements
Professional experience building iOS applications using Swift, with strong knowledge of object-oriented programming, SwiftUI
Comfortable working in and improving large, existing codebases, including refactoring Objective-C and maintaining clean, maintainable code
Responsibilities
Develop and maintain SoundCloud’s Artist experience on iOS, delivering responsive, high-quality user experiences
Contribute to the modernization of our codebase by refactoring Objective-C and modularizing components using Swift and SwiftUI
Build and optimize UI components using SwiftUI, with a focus on performance, accessibility, and platform consistency
Collaborate closely with cross-functional teams—including product, design, backend, and analytics—to define, build, and iterate on features
Support experimentation and data-driven product development by integrating A/B testing and tracking into mobile features
Take part in architectural decisions, code reviews, and engineering best practices to ensure maintainable, scalable mobile development
Other
Skilled at working in cross-functional teams, proactively communicating, and breaking down complex problems into simple, elegant solutions
Thrives in a collaborative, agile environment, while also capable of working independently and taking initiative
Passionate about music, mobile development, and building intuitive, high-impact experiences for millions of users
Flexible work culture that offers the opportunity to collaborate and connect in person at our offices as well as accommodating work from home
Deeply committed to ensuring diversity, equity and inclusion at all levels of our organization and fostering a community where everyone’s voice, perspective and experience is respected and heard